Robert Lewandowski has added another glittering chapter to his legendary career, as the Polish striker was officially presented with the European Golden Shoe following a phenomenal season with FC Bayern München. The award, given annually to the top goal scorer across Europe’s domestic leagues, is a recognition of Lewandowski’s relentless scoring ability, consistency, and influence at the heart of Bayern’s attacking power.
Lewandowski’s achievement is particularly remarkable considering the level of competition in Europe’s top divisions. During the previous campaign, the Bayern No. 9 netted an astonishing 41 goals in the Bundesliga, breaking the long-standing record held by Gerd Müller for most goals scored in a single season. His tally not only placed him well ahead of his closest rivals across the continent but also underlined his status as one of the finest strikers of his generation.
